The Minnesota Lynx today announced their national broadcast schedule for the 2025 WNBA season. Per the league’s deal, ION will nationally televise each of the seven Minnesota games on Friday nights, beginning with Minnesota’s season opener on Friday, May 16 at 6:30 p.m. CT against the Dallas Wings. Fourteen of the 21 nationally televised games include standalone broadcasts on ION (7), ABC (3), ESPN (2), and CBS (2).
Additional national broadcast partners of the WNBA include Prime Video, NBA TV, CBS Sports Network, ESPN3 and WNBA League Pass. The Lynx will have one game on Prime Video, five games on NBA TV, one game on CBS Sports Network and three games on ESPN3.
Local television and radio broadcast schedules to be released at a later date.
The 2025 season features 44 regular season games from May 16 through Sept. 11.
